Parents give their children names based on several factors, including cultures, tribe, tradition and appeal.
Some love to give complicated names that are difficult for others, including the bearer of the name, to pronounce.
Swahili names are perfect since every vowel is sounded out; thus, they are simple for anyone to pronounce correctly the first time.
Several charming Swahili boy names with strong significances are available for parents to choose from for their children.
.co.ke Here are some wonderful and attractive Swahili names for your little bundle of joy.
1. Jabali
According to Mom Junction, the word means "strong as a rock," it can typify a boy's strength.
It could indicate physical prowess as well as emotional or mental fortitude, making it a form of positive reinforcement.
2. Bahati

The name Bahati signifies good fortune or being fortunate, suggesting an individual who enjoys favor and prosperity without necessarily earning them through effort. This implies that their advantages come from sheer luck rather than personal achievement.
3. Mwanga
Its meaning can be equivalent to the Swahili name Nuru, which denotes light or radiance.
This illumination might not specifically be akin to sunlight, yet it could represent solutions, happiness, and insight.

6. Taji
The Wa Jesus couple has named theri firstborn son Taji, which means crown and symbolises royalty.
The title also represents leadership, authority, and an individual or entity worthy of great admiration.
7. Fadhili
Christians grasp this concept better when applied to God, encompassing favor, assistance, or benevolence.
The name Fadhili belongs to someone who has been bestowed favor and viewed with kindness and compassion.
8. Johari
Sometimes spelt as Jahari, a boy's name means jewel, something precious, like a gemstone.
Though sometimes it could be primarily for females, it can be used for the male gender and would sound sweet.
9. Amani
The charming name signifies peace and might refer to a person who promotes harmony or is typically calm.
10. Jasiri
As parents often choose names to reflect the kind of person they hope their children will become, Jasiri is a wonderful choice.
This signifies being bold, indicating someone who exhibits courage and isn’t intimidated by facing any obstacle.
